The subtle difference hinges on the chemical content. Chemical Comparison of Cast Light weight aluminum Alloys Silicon advertises castability by lowering the alloy's melting temperature and boosting fluidity during casting. It plays an essential duty in enabling detailed molds to be filled properly. Additionally, silicon adds to the alloy's strength and put on resistance, making it beneficial in applications where resilience is crucial, such as automobile components and engine components.It likewise improves the machinability of the alloy, making it easier to refine into finished items. In this way, iron adds to the general workability of aluminum alloys.
Manganese adds to the strength of aluminum alloys and boosts workability (aluminum casting manufacturer). It is generally made use of in functioned light weight aluminum products like sheets, extrusions, and profiles. The visibility of manganese help in the alloy's formability and resistance to splitting throughout fabrication processes. Magnesium is a lightweight component that provides toughness and impact resistance to light weight aluminum alloys.

It allows the production of light-weight components with excellent mechanical properties. Zinc enhances the castability of aluminum alloys and helps manage the solidification procedure throughout casting. It boosts the alloy's strength and solidity. It is usually located in applications where complex forms and fine details are required, such as attractive spreadings and specific auto parts.

The main thermal conductivity, tensile toughness, yield stamina, and prolongation vary. Select ideal basic materials according to the performance of the target product created. Amongst the above alloys, A356 has the highest possible thermal conductivity, and A380 and ADC12 have the most affordable. The tensile restriction is the opposite. A360 has the very best return toughness and the greatest prolongation rate.

When you have chosen that the light weight aluminum die casting procedure appropriates for your project, an essential next step is picking the most suitable alloy. The aluminum alloy you select will substantially affect both the spreading process and the residential properties of the last item. As a result of this, you must make your choice carefully and take an enlightened method.
Establishing the most appropriate aluminum alloy for your application will imply weighing a wide variety of attributes. The first group addresses alloy qualities that impact the production process.

The alloy you choose for die spreading straight affects several elements of the spreading process, like just how simple the alloy is to collaborate with and if it is prone to casting issues. Warm cracking, additionally referred to as solidification cracking, is a regular die casting defect for aluminum alloys that can lead to inner or surface-level rips or splits.
Certain light weight aluminum alloys are a lot more vulnerable to hot fracturing than others, and your choice needs to consider this. Another common flaw discovered in the die casting of aluminum is die soldering, which is when the cast sticks to the die walls and makes ejection challenging. It can harm both the actors and the die, so you need to look for alloys with high anti-soldering homes.
Corrosion resistance, which is already a noteworthy feature of aluminum, can differ considerably from alloy to alloy and is a vital particular to consider depending on the environmental problems your product will certainly be revealed to (Aluminum Castings).
